Analysis
Malta recorded 99 1000 USD for netherlands (kingdom of the) — sawnwood, non-coniferous all — import in 2016.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 371.4% on the previous year and down 49.5% over ten years.
Over the whole period, netherlands (kingdom of the) — sawnwood, non-coniferous all — import in Malta peaked at 196 1000 USD in 2006 and was at its lowest, 0 1000 USD, in 2000.
Malta ranks 40th of 74 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
